New investment in Tanzania’s railways sector is expected to directly benefit nearly 900,000 people and indirectly impact an estimated 3.5 million. Tanzania operates two railway systems, totaling 3,682 km in length. Tanzania railway sector is poised for immense growth as the World Bank poured significant funding by approving $200 million in financing from the International Development Association (IDA) which is a part of the bank. According to available information from the World Bank statement made on Friday, the bank said the financing for the second phase of the Tanzania Intermodal and Rail Development Project (TIRP-2) will improve safety,…

Tanzania’s agriculture sector holds one-third of the country’s GDP and employs 75 per cent of the population. The government target is to raise crop exports by 48 per cent to $3.5 billion by 2025 as food shipments rise to overtake the value that Tanzania earns from its traditional export crops. Tanzania earned over $1.2 billion with the export of agricultural commodities in 2020. An outlook into Tanzania’s agriculture sector Numbers show that farmers are Tanzania’s most essential workforce. The Tanzania Electric Supply Company (Tanesco) is currently implementing almost ten hours of power rationing across the country. Tanzanian President Samia Suluhu Hassan has instructed the Tanesco chief to resolve the power rationing issue within six months. The country’s electricity grid is facing a shortage of 400 megawatts due to low water flow and maintenance issues. Dear customer, please find today’s schedule for power rationing. This message has become all too familiar to millions of Tanzanians every morning, depressing news that now servs as a wake-up alarm from utility Tanzania Electric Supply Company (Tanesco). Indonesia has agreed to support Tanzania in developing its agriculture industry through funding and training at the Farmers Agriculture and Rural Training Centre in Morogoro. Additionally, Indonesia, which also has a thriving pharmaceutical industry, will invest in Tanzania through its pharmaceutical companies. As part of this expanding collaboration, the Diplomatic Schools of Tanzania and Indonesia have agreed to exchange students and professors. A mutually beneficial trade and investment partnership is blossoming between Tanzania and Indonesia.
